- 博客(68)
- 资源 (2)
- 收藏
- 关注
原创 10.1 JSP语言入门
JSP是一种服务器端技术,类似于PHP和ASP,主要用于生成动态网页内容。JSP文件扩展名为.jsp,内部可以包含HTML、Java代码、以及JSP标签。是一种简洁的语法,用于访问Java对象的属性,调用方法等。EL使得在JSP中嵌入Java代码更加简单和直观。JSTL是一个标准标签库,为JSP提供了一组常用功能,如条件判断、循环、国际化等。创建自定义标签可以提高代码的重用性和可读性。步骤创建标签处理类,继承TagSupport或SimpleTagSupport。定义标签库描述文件(TLD)。
2024-07-15 11:11:40
888
原创 9.7 Go语言入门(映射 Map)
在 Go 语言中,映射(Map)是一种内置的数据结构,它是一种键值对的集合,提供了高效的键值对查找、插入和删除操作。
2024-06-03 14:11:12
1061
1
原创 4.21 Python实现将文件夹中的文件压缩
运行这个脚本后,您将在 C:\Users\15640\Desktop\git 文件夹中找到一个名为 abc.zip 的压缩包,其中包含 abc 文件夹中的所有文件。
2024-06-03 13:30:33
553
1
原创 2.11 下载安装Oracle数据库(Win10 JP)
Oracle版本: Oracle Database 11g 11.2.0.4.0 ( Oracle Database Enterprise Edition, Oracle Database Standard Edition )关于在 Windows 上安装 Oracle Database 11g 的详细指南,您可以参考以下教程:在 Windows 上安装 Oracle Database 11g (Oracle)。上面已经安装了Oracle 11g 客户端,这里直接选12c数据库就可以。
2024-05-30 16:07:45
1300
2
原创 2.10 mysql设置远程访问权限
确认当前登录用户有足够的权限: 确保你使用的是具有足够权限的 MySQL 用户(如 root 用户)。确认 MySQL 服务正在运行: 确认 MySQL 服务已经启动并正常运行。允许所有IP地址连接,或者设置为服务器的IP地址。允许所有IP地址连接,或者设置为服务器的IP地址。一、Mysql8.0 设置远程访问权限。Mysql8.0 设置远程访问权限。********你的数据库密码。出现 % 即表明修改成功。mysql设置远程访问权限。最后重启mysql数据库。
2024-05-29 18:18:46
699
原创 9.6 Go语言入门(数组、切片和指针)
在 Go 语言中,数组、切片和指针是非常重要的数据结构和概念。它们各自有不同的用途和特性,理解它们有助于编写高效和清晰的代码。下面详细讲解 Go 语言中的数组、切片和指针,并提供代码示例。Go 语言(Golang)是一种静态类型、编译型语言,由 Google 开发,专注于简洁性、并发和高效性。在 Go 中,指针可以用来传递大对象以避免拷贝,提高性能。通过理解数组、切片和指针,能够更好地处理复杂的数据结构和内存管理,提高程序的效率和性能。切片支持切片操作符,允许从现有切片中创建新的切片。
2024-05-24 16:51:32
1349
5
原创 9.5 Go语言入门(条件语句和循环语句)
Go 语言中,条件语句和循环语句是控制程序流的基本结构。下面详细讲解 Go 语言中的条件语句和循环语句,并提供代码示例。通过理解条件语句和循环语句,可以编写逻辑复杂且结构清晰的 Go 语言程序。Go 语言还支持 goto 语句用于无条件跳转,尽量避免使用 goto,以保持代码的可读性和可维护性。if 语句支持在条件判断之前执行一个简单的语句。这个语句的作用域仅限于 if 语句块。switch 语句可以不带表达式,这时每个 case 都是一个独立的条件判断。可以省略 for 循环的初始化语句和后置语句。
2024-05-24 15:56:04
1031
原创 9.4 Go语言入门(运算符)
运算符的优先级决定了它们在表达式中计算的顺序。高优先级的运算符在低优先级的运算符之前执行。在 Go 语言中,运算符是用于执行各种操作的符号或关键字。运算符可以用于数值计算、比较操作、逻辑运算、位操作等。Go 语言(Golang)是一种静态类型、编译型语言,由 Google 开发,专注于简洁性、并发和高效性。通过理解和掌握这些运算符及其使用方法,可以有效地编写和调试 Go 语言代码。下面是 Go 语言的基础语法讲解和代码示例。位运算符用于对整数类型的位进行操作。算术运算符用于执行基本的数学运算。
2024-05-23 14:58:11
1025
原创 9.2 Go语言入门(包和导入)
在 Go 中,每个源文件都必须属于一个包。包的声明使用 package 关键字,通常放在文件的第一行。包名决定了该文件所属的包。
2024-05-22 14:29:00
1231
原创 9.1 Go语言入门(环境篇)
Go语言是一种由谷歌开发的开源编程语言,也被称为Golang。它于2009年首次发布,并在编程社区中迅速获得关注和流行。Go语言的设计目标是提供一种简单、高效、可靠的编程语言,适用于大规模软件开发。并发支持:Go语言在语言级别提供了并发支持,通过goroutine和channel来实现轻量级的并发编程,使得编写并发程序更加简单和高效。高性能:Go语言通过优秀的编译器和运行时系统,以及对原生代码的支持,可以提供出色的性能。简洁易读:Go语言倡导简洁的语法和清晰的代码结构,使得代码更易读、易维护。内置工具。
2024-05-22 10:55:15
987
原创 6.4 ServiceNow ATF 运行测试并审查测试结果
请注意,测试运行分为两个编号的批次:一个执行服务器测试步骤,另一个执行用户界面测试步骤。根据实例数据验证复制的快速启动测试运行。
2024-05-20 17:03:08
421
原创 8.2 GOOGLE(SAML应用)登录联携AWS用户池(Amazon Cognito)
在这篇博客中,我们将介绍如何使用 Google SAML 应用程序登录并将其与 AWS 用户池(Amazon Cognito)联携起来。通过这种方法,可以实现用户使用 Google 账号登录,然后在 AWS Cognito 中进行身份验证和管理。
2024-05-15 11:29:36
1266
1
原创 8.1 AWS创建用户池(Amazon Cognito)和用户
Amazon Cognito 是亚马逊提供的一种身份验证、授权和用户管理服务。它为开发人员提供了一种简单的方式来添加用户身份验证和授权功能到其应用程序中,而无需管理自己的身份验证系统。总之,Amazon Cognito 是一个强大的身份验证和用户管理服务,可以帮助开发人员轻松地构建安全可靠的应用程序,并集成了各种身份提供者和数据同步功能。
2024-05-08 15:52:02
821
原创 5.12 VUE项目实现Google 第三方登录
这篇文章介绍了如何在Vue.js项目中实现Google第三方登录功能。它涵盖了使用Google开发者控制台创建OAuth 2.0凭证、安装必要的依赖库、设置前端路由和组件,以及在后端处理用户认证的过程。通过详细的步骤和示例代码,读者可以轻松地将Google登录集成到他们的Vue.js应用程序中。
2024-05-07 16:20:39
2680
4
原创 2.9 VM17虚拟机安装Centos系统和docker
本文旨在为初学者提供在 VM17 虚拟机上安装 CentOS 系统和 Docker 的简易指南。首先,介绍了 CentOS 操作系统的稳定性和可靠性,以及 Docker 容器技术的优势。接着,详细说明了在 VM17 虚拟机上创建新的虚拟机并安装 CentOS 操作系统的步骤,包括设置虚拟机的参数和安装过程中的注意事项。随后,介绍了使用 yum 命令安装 Docker 所需的依赖软件包的步骤,并解释了其中的错误和解决方法。最后,提供了在 CentOS 中安装 Docker 的简易步骤,包括..........
2024-04-30 16:14:00
1631
4
原创 2.8 构建gradle环境
Gradle是一种现代化的构建工具,用于自动化地构建、测试和部署软件项目。它是一种基于JVM(Java虚拟机)的构建工具,最初是为了解决Apache Ant和Apache Maven等传统构建工具的一些限制而开发的。
2024-04-18 17:22:03
2940
2
原创 7.1 搭建个人网站-申请免费域名
Eu.org是一个免费的域名注册服务,提供.eu.org域名。这个服务允许用户在.eu.org域名下注册子域名,例如example.eu.org。Eu.org域名并非由欧盟管理,而是由一家名为Free Domain Registry的组织管理。Eu.org域名通常被用于个人网站、小型组织和非营利性机构。
2024-04-11 14:19:05
527
原创 5.11 Vue配置Element UI框架
Element UI 的设计灵感来源于 Google Material Design 和 Apple 的 Human Interface Guidelines,具有简洁明了的风格和丰富的组件,包括按钮、表单、弹窗、导航菜单、表格等常用组件,同时支持自定义主题和国际化。这个插件可以帮助你在使用 Vue.js 组件库时,只引入你实际需要的组件,而不是全部组件,从而减小最终打包生成的文件大小。当你使用 babel-plugin-component 时,你可以在代码中按需引入组件,而不需要手动引入每个组件。
2024-03-29 16:48:56
1062
原创 6.3 ServiceNow ATF 复制和配置快速启动测试
添加、更改或删除验证独特功能业务逻辑所需的测试步骤。这就是复制和自定义快速入门测试以满足您独特需求的全部内容。只需将复制的测试添加到测试套件中,就可以运行了。
2024-03-21 17:33:58
801
原创 6.2 ServiceNow 自动化测试框架 (ATF) 简介
ServiceNow 自动化测试框架(Automated Test Framework(ATF))是ServiceNow平台上的一种自动化测试工具,旨在帮助开发人员和测试人员快速、高效地创建和运行测试用例。ATF允许用户记录和回放交互式测试,同时还支持JavaScript编写的自定义测试脚本。通过ATF,用户可以轻松地执行端到端的集成测试,确保应用程序在ServiceNow平台上的正常运行。ATF提供了丰富的功能,包括创建测试套件、记录测试步骤、管理测试数据、执行测试、生成测试报告等。
2024-03-21 14:57:44
1678
原创 1.9 java实现License认证信息的加密解密处理
License认证是一种用于验证软件或Web系统合法性和授权使用的机制。以下是一种常见的License认证实现方式:生成License密钥对:使用非对称加密算法(如RSA),生成一对公钥和私钥。私钥将用于生成License文件,公钥将用于验证License文件的合法性。定义License文件格式:确定License文件的格式和内容。产品名称和版本号授权用户信息有效期其他自定义信息(如限制功能、用户数量等)
2023-11-30 17:56:03
3990
原创 4.20 Python实现定时任务的多种方案及代码示例
Python定时任务是指在程序运行过程中,周期性地执行一些特定的任务,比如每天定时执行某个函数或者脚本等。它可以免去手动重复执行某些操作的繁琐,提高工作效率和准确性。Python定时任务的原理是基于计划任务(Cron Job)或调度器来实现的。计划任务是一种在Linux系统下常见的定时任务管理方式,而调度器则是Python中实现定时任务的一种方式。调度器的原理是通过创建一个线程来不断运行,并根据给定的时间间隔或时间点来执行指定的任务。
2023-10-08 17:33:17
456
1
原创 4.12 Pandas中的DataFrame数据类型API函数参考手册(二) (Python)
Pandas 是一个专门用于数据处理和分析的 Python 库,它提供了众多强大的数据结构和函数,帮助用户更加轻松、高效地完成数据处理和分析任务。其中,DataFrame 数据类型是 Pandas 中非常重要的一种数据结构,可以方便地对二维表格数据进行操作、处理、统计和可视化等工作。可以灵活处理不同类型的数据,包括数字、文本、日期等等。提供了许多强大的数据处理函数,比如过滤、排序、聚合等操作。方便进行数据可视化和统计分析,例如可视化不同变量之间的关系、计算各种统计量等。
2023-06-19 14:44:32
1964
1
原创 4.11 Pandas中的DataFrame数据类型API函数参考手册(一) (Python)
Pandas 是一个专门用于数据处理和分析的 Python 库,它提供了众多强大的数据结构和函数,帮助用户更加轻松、高效地完成数据处理和分析任务。其中,DataFrame 数据类型是 Pandas 中非常重要的一种数据结构,可以方便地对二维表格数据进行操作、处理、统计和可视化等工作。可以灵活处理不同类型的数据,包括数字、文本、日期等等。提供了许多强大的数据处理函数,比如过滤、排序、聚合等操作。方便进行数据可视化和统计分析,例如可视化不同变量之间的关系、计算各种统计量等。
2023-06-16 15:19:35
2027
1
原创 5.10 Vue配置路由(vue-router)
Vue Router 是 Vue.js 官方提供的一种路由管理工具,它可以帮助开发者管理 Vue.js 应用程序的路由,并实现路由跳转、参数传递、嵌套路由等功能。Vue Router 可以将一个单页面应用分成多个视图,在不同的路由之间进行切换,从而实现了应用程序的多页面效果。Vue Router 的核心是路由器(router),路由器负责监听变化并解析 URL,并指导应用程序渲染正确的组件,并在组件之间进行切换。
2023-06-07 15:03:00
6141
1
原创 5.9 使用Vue CLI创建VUE项目
Vue.js是一款流行的JavaScript框架,它是一个渐进式框架,可以根据应用程序的规模灵活选择使用哪些功能。以下是将Vue.js整合到CSND中所需的步骤
2023-06-06 13:17:13
838
原创 5.8 几个常见JavaScript图表库
Chartist.js是一个精简但功能强大的JavaScript图表库,它专注于提供简单、响应式、可定制和易于使用的图表。总的来说,Plotly是一款功能丰富、易于使用、灵活性强的JavaScript图表库,可以帮助用户轻松地创建各种类型的数据可视化图表。总之,Chart.js 是一个功能丰富、易于使用、轻量级的图表库,可以帮助开发者快速构建各种类型的图表。总之,ECharts 是一个功能强大、使用方便、兼容性好的图表库,可以满足各种数据可视化的需求。这些库还有许多其他的特性和优点,可以根据需求进行选择。
2023-06-02 10:56:35
2197
原创 5.7 Vue中this.$nextTick()方法的使用及代码示例
nextTick() 是 Vue.js 框架中的一个方法,它主要用于 DOM 操作。当我们修改 Vue 组件中的数据时,Vue.js 会在下次事件循环前自动更新视图,并异步执行 $nextTick() 中的回调函数。这个过程可以确保 DOM 已经被更新,以及可以操作到最新的 DOM。具体来说,当修改了 Vue 组件中的数据时,Vue.js 并不会立即进行视图更新。Vue.js 会将修改的数据记录下来,并在下一次事件循环时才更新视图。
2023-05-25 09:47:02
43178
1
原创 5.6 Vue中的localStorage和sessionStorage浏览器端数据存储机制
在 Vue 中,localStorage 是一种用于浏览器端数据存储的机制,它可以让你把数据存储在客户端本地。
2023-04-26 16:27:05
3931
原创 5.5 Vue中的ref引用机制
Vue 的 ref 是一种引用机制,通过给元素或组件指定 ref 属性,可以在 Vue 实例中访问到对应的元素或组件实例。
2023-04-26 11:52:09
1148
原创 5.4 Javascript中的浅拷贝与深拷贝
JavaScript 中的浅拷贝和深拷贝是常见的两种对象复制方式,它们分别从不同的角度来复制对象的属性和方法。
2023-04-24 15:02:43
689
原创 4.10 python调用opanai API实现人机交互
OpenAI是一家AI研究和部署公司。我们的使命是确保通用人工智能造福全人类。OpenAI API 几乎可以应用于任何涉及理解或生成自然语言或代码的任务。我们提供一系列具有不同功率水平的型号,适用于不同的任务,并能够微调您自己的定制模型。这些模型可用于从内容生成到语义搜索和分类的所有内容。
2023-02-22 16:42:47
1561
2
原创 4.9 Pandas中的Dataframe 数据分组(Python)
根据统计研究的需要,将原始数据按照某种标准划分成不同的组别,分组后的的数据称为分组数据。
2023-02-10 17:43:56
4794
原创 4.8 Pandas中的Dataframe 缺失值NaN数据处理(Python)
数据的缺失导致NaN的出现,直接插入DB中会报错,所以要特殊处理一下。
2023-02-10 11:20:05
4425
原创 4.7 Pandas中的Dataframe数据选取(三)(Python)
区域选取可以从多个维度(行和列)对数据进行筛选,可以通过df.loc[],df.iloc[],df.ix[]三种方法实现。
2023-02-09 14:00:19
2285
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人